How the Concept Works
The operation of casino games that pay real money involves several key components:
- Game selection : Casinos offer an array of games designed to generate revenue. These can be categorized into slots, table games (e.g., roulette, blackjack), and specialty titles.
- Random Number Generators (RNGs) : Online casino software uses RNGs to ensure the fairness and randomness of game outcomes. This technology ensures that each spin, roll, or card deal is independent and unpredictable.
- House edge : To maintain a profit margin, casinos calculate a built-in advantage over players through various mathematical formulas. The house edge dictates how much money the casino expects to win over time from every bet placed.
Types or Variations
Casino games that pay real money come in many forms:
- Tournament-based games : Participants compete against each other for monetary prizes, with some variations incorporating leaderboards and progressive jackpots.
- Progressive slots : Slots linked together to build a massive shared jackpot, which grows as players bet on these specific titles.
- Live dealer games : Online versions of table games hosted by human dealers via live streaming technology, often offering real-money stakes for players worldwide.

Legal or Regional Context
Regulations surrounding real-money casino gaming vary across regions. Players must be aware of the laws governing iGaming in their country to avoid any issues with withdrawal restrictions, winnings seizures, or even prosecution.
Some notable jurisdictions include:
- United Kingdom: Online gambling regulated under a strict licensing system
- United States: Varies by state; some allow real-money gaming while others restrict it
- Australia and New Zealand: Governed by separate laws for land-based casinos, online sports betting, and iGaming
